DebugServer2
|
This is the complete list of members for ds2::SoftwareBreakpointManager, including all inherited members.
_process (defined in ds2::BreakpointManager) | ds2::BreakpointManager | protected |
_sites (defined in ds2::BreakpointManager) | ds2::BreakpointManager | protected |
add(Address const &address, Lifetime lifetime, size_t size, Mode mode) (defined in ds2::BreakpointManager) | ds2::BreakpointManager | virtual |
BreakpointManager(Target::ProcessBase *process) (defined in ds2::BreakpointManager) | ds2::BreakpointManager | protected |
chooseBreakpointSize(Address const &address) const override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| protectedvirtual |
clear() override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| virtual |
disable(Target::Thread *thread=nullptr) override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| virtual |
disableLocation(Site const &site, Target::Thread *thread=nullptr) override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| protectedvirtual |
enable(Target::Thread *thread=nullptr) override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| virtual |
enabled(Target::Thread *thread=nullptr) const override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| protectedvirtual |
enableLocation(Site const &site, Target::Thread *thread=nullptr) override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| protectedvirtual |
enumerate(std::function< void(Site const &)> const &cb) const (defined in ds2::BreakpointManager) | ds2::BreakpointManager | virtual |
fillStopInfo(Target::Thread *thread, StopInfo &stopInfo) override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| virtual |
getOpcode(size_t size, ByteVector &opcode) const (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| protectedvirtual |
has(Address const &address) const (defined in ds2::BreakpointManager) | ds2::BreakpointManager | virtual |
hit(Target::Thread *thread, Site &site) override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| virtual |
hit(Address const &address, Site &site) (defined in ds2::BreakpointManager) | ds2::BreakpointManager | protectedvirtual |
isValid(Address const &address, size_t size, Mode mode) const override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| protectedvirtual |
kModeExec enum value (defined in ds2::BreakpointManager) | ds2::BreakpointManager | |
kModeRead enum value (defined in ds2::BreakpointManager) | ds2::BreakpointManager | |
kModeWrite enum value (defined in ds2::BreakpointManager) | ds2::BreakpointManager | |
Lifetime enum name (defined in ds2::BreakpointManager) | ds2::BreakpointManager | |
Mode enum name (defined in ds2::BreakpointManager) | ds2::BreakpointManager | |
remove(Address const &address) (defined in ds2::BreakpointManager) | ds2::BreakpointManager | virtual |
SiteMap typedef (defined in ds2::BreakpointManager) | ds2::BreakpointManager | |
SoftwareBreakpointManager(Target::ProcessBase *process) (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ager | |
~BreakpointManager() (defined in ds2::BreakpointManager) | ds2::BreakpointManager | virtual |
~SoftwareBreakpointManager() override (defined in ds2::SoftwareBreakpointManager) | ds2::SoftwareBreakpointManager |